使用 JavaScript 源映射(.map 文件)
源映射(.map 文件)伴随缩小的 JavaScript、CSS 和 TypeScript 文件,增强调试能力。这些文件允许开发人员将缩小的代码追溯到其原始的、未缩小的状态。
源映射的目的
缩小文件时,其可读代码被压缩,使得它对于生产环境非常有效。源映射弥补了缩小后的代码与其原始形式之间的差距。
源映射的使用
开发人员可以利用源映射来调试生产错误。在开发中,可以访问库的完整版本(例如 Angular),但在生产中,部署的是缩小版本。源映射可以将错误追溯到原始代码。
源映射的创建
源映射是在构建过程中创建的。 webpack 等构建工具可以自动生成 .map 文件和其他项目文件。
Source Maps 的好处
注意事项
一个潜在的限制是如果输出文件不在项目根目录中,源映射可能会失败。
结论
源映射在 JavaScript 开发中发挥着至关重要的作用,为开发人员提供了意味着调试精简代码并提高错误消息的准确性。如果您重视生产代码的轻松调试,强烈建议在构建过程中实现 .map 文件的创建。
以上是源映射如何增强 JavaScript 调试?的详细内容。更多信息请关注PHP中文网其他相关文章!